Description
给出一个大小为n×m 的二维数组a[i][j] ,初始全 0.
q 次操作,每次给出五个整数x1,y1,x2,y2,c ,要求使a[i][j]+=c(x1≤i≤x2,y1≤j≤y2).
q次操作完成后,输出整个数组a[i][j] .
第一行有三个整数,n,m 表示数组长度,q 表示操作次数.
之后有q 行,每行有五个整数x1,y1,x2,y2,c 表示使$a[i][j]+=c(x_{1}\le i\le x_{2},y_{1}\le j\le y_{2})$ .
1≤n,m≤103
1≤q,c,a[i][j]≤105
1≤x1,x2≤n
.1≤y1,y2≤m
Output
q次操作完成后,输出整个二维数组a[i][j](1≤i≤n,1≤j≤m) .
Samples
4 5 2
1 1 1 1 1
2 3 4 5 2
1 0 0 0 0
0 0 2 2 2
0 0 2 2 2
0 0 2 2 2